    I was planning to put a lift on my 2006 Tacoma but never followed through. I bought these brake lines and they have just sat in the garage for the past year unused. This is a four line set (front and rear) and will extend your brake line length four inches and give you all the benefits of upgrading to stainless lines. These can also be used without a lift installed. The longer length will have NO effect on functionality. The part number is 4-21155.
